Let Your TMS and Machine Tools Talk Amongst Themselves
- By Doug Sumner
- Aug 30, 2014
- Management
- Article
Tool management system software paired with advanced presetters can add to a shop’s bottom line by reducing setup time, increasing productivity, eliminating tool setup error, and building a tool library specific to any facility.
